Mock Tests in Knotty Ash

FAQ
The session runs as close to a real DVSA test as possible. Your instructor directs you along a pre-planned route on residential and rural roads and assesses your driving in silence, just as an examiner would. That covers general road driving, independent driving, junctions and roundabouts, manoeuvres, speed awareness, lane discipline, observation, and planning. Afterwards you get a full debrief.
Bring your provisional driving licence and glasses or contact lenses if you need them for driving — the same things you'd need on real test day. Your instructor provides the dual-control car, so there's nothing else to organise.
